WebActive beam stabilization, alignment, guidance, and beam switching of lasers. Aligna is a complete solution for beam pointing stabilization and/or beam guidance. The control electronics, a combined angle and position detector and two active mirrors form a feedback loop, which suppresses thermal drifts as well as fast fluctuations.
